I was aftersome race boots in november last year. I went around all the local bikes shop as I always do when looking for new stuff and tried most boots available for under £250

I ended up with some Alpinestar SMX+ boots. I have a dodgy ankle and these provided the most ankle support out of any boot, felt to provide themost protection, they feel amazing through the pegs and you can feel exactly what going on and they were almost the most comfortable

Cant remember how much they were but between £160 - £180 rings a bell
